TE Connectivity has unveiled a new technology platform that will allow the delivery of robust power, signals and data without any physical connectors or contact, in virtually any environment. The ARISO contactless connectivity solution integrates seamlessly wireless power and radio frequency (RF) technology.

The ARISO contactless connectivity enables new applications and solutions where traditional cables and connectors fail, reducing maintenance costs as there is no physical contact causing wear and tear on the connector. Hermetically sealed, the TE ARISO contactless connectivity couples are not susceptible to dirt, dust or chemical fluids making them ideal for deployment in ruggedized environments and clean environments such as food & beverage production.

Easily scalable, the platform eliminates current mechanical design barriers, it can transfer power and signal through fluids and walls. Because it is contactless, the solution minimizes risk in flammable environments, it cannot cause an arc as it generates a magnetic rather than an electric field.
